ANXIOUS OBJECTS: WILLIE COLE'S FAVORITE BRANDS
ANXIOUS OBJECTS was published in late 2005 as a companion to Willie Cole's first comprehensive survey show of the same title.
The exhibition traveled to 6 major US museums between 2006 and 2008 and broke museum attendance records at every venue. This
book includes over 100 full color images of Cole's work ranging from his 2 dimensional works from the 1980's up to the earliest
examples of the iconic shoe sculptures from 2005. It also includes a conversation between the artist and Leslie Hammond
King of the Maryland Institute College of Art, an essay by Lowery Stokes Sims of the Museum of Art and Design (NYC), and extensive
text compiled from interviews and conversations between the artist and Patterson Sims; the exhibition curator and director
of the Montclair Art Museum (NJ).
